Abstract


In this globalized world, English plays an important role as the international language. However, many workers in transportation industry, especially the drivers, who are non-native English speakers, struggle to communicate in English. Therefore, an English module is needed to fulfill the drivers’ practical needs.

This research is intended to create a Basic English module for the drivers. This research shows how “Basic English for Driver” module is designed and what the designs of “Basic English for Driver” materials look like. Therefore, the drivers can get help in learning Basic English.

The method employed in this research is the combination of four steps of Research and Development (RnD) by Borg and Gall (1983) and the four steps of ADDIE instructional design. The study involves drivers from PT. Transportasi Velocity Indonesia and a learning media expert from Sanata Dharma University. This research implements a Likert-scale questionnaire to obtain needs analysis, expert assessment, and feedback. In addition, the data is analyzed by interpreting the needs analysis data in the form of a written analysis and implementing descriptive statistics to derive the average score.

The expert’s feedback was very positive. The positive evaluation from the expert indicated this module as the potential to enhance drivers’ English skills. This was identified according to the average score which is 3.9 out of 4.0.
